Our thick-cut smoked bacon is 1mm thicker than our average organic and free-range bacons. It's marvellous breakfast bacon. The fatter slices are also ideal for snipping into lardons, say if you want to add a few nuggets of smoky bacon to a pot of slow-cooked lentils. This thick-cut bacon has approximately 5-6 slices in a pack.

Producer

This pork comes from Newington Farm in Gloucestershire, which is run by Richard Hazell, who farms specifically to offer people the next best thing to organic. Richard says, “I acquired Newington Farm in response to recent economic pressure on the organic industry and the recession affecting consumer's food budgets.” Newington Farm is a traditional free range farm where he raises pigs to the highest animal health and welfare standards. Newington Farm is not certified as organic but instead provides you with the opportunity to buy truly superior free range pork at an affordable price.

Storage & prep

Grill or fry bacon until it begins to crisp, and press it between two soft white slices of bread, preferably home-baked or unsliced. Add a little brown sauce or ketchup for the perfect bacon sandwich. Toast the bread, and add lettuce, tomato and mayonnaise for a great BLT. Bacon can also be used in pasta dishes and salads, as part of a full English breakfast, or to add flavour to cooking poultry. Bacon, cream and leeks, or bacon, breadcrumbs and parsley, make a perfect pasta accompaniment. Bacon should be kept in the fridge, and should not be stored above other food, unless in a sealed container. It can be frozen on the day of purchase.
